Leadership failure responsible for our defeat in Ondo – PDP youths

By: Hakeem Gbadamosi – Akure

The youth wing of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in Ondo state said the leadership of the party in the state largely responsible for the failure of the party at the just concluded presidential election of February 25.

The youths under the aegis of Council of Young Leaders in Peoples Democratic Party (CYLI-PDP) said the internal crisis within the party in the state led to the poor performance of the party in the Presidential election and the House of Assembly election in the state.

In a statement by the youth group, signed by its coordinator, Mr. Wande Ajayi, noted that the PDP as the main opposition party in the state has failed to challenge the recklessness of the ruling All Progressives Congress (APC) in the state.

Ajayi said the PDP under the present leadership in the state in the last two years has become an intrepid, weak, ineffectual and highly fragmented association of strange bedfellows, responsible for the failure of the party in the state.

He said: “The Council of Young Leaders in Peoples Democratic Party (CYLI-PDP) hereby expresses its deep sadness at the dismal and shameful performance of the Ondo state chapter of the party in the last Presidential, National Assembly and State House of Assembly elections.

“We are concerned that the PDP, which once served as the major opposition party to challenge the recklessness of the incumbent APC, has over the last two years become an intrepid, weak, ineffectual and highly fragmented association of strange bedfellows.

“We remain concerned that the state leadership has been unable to administer the party in such a way and manner as to achieve its primary purpose of winning elections.

“We have squandered our goodwill with the good people of Ondo state and have become a third-rated political party within a very short period of time.

“It is noteworthy to state, that the Ondo State PDP under it’s current leadership, has failed to improve over its successes in the 2019 national elections, but has fallen dramatically to a level where it now plays catch-up to other parties. Needless to say that the outcome of the last presidential election suffices as evidence”

The youth however, called on stakeholders at the state and national office of the party to come to the aid of the party in the state before the current leadership wreck the party in the state.

Ajayi warned that dismissing the issues and points raised by the PDP youths without looking into ways of resolving the crises will not only dangerous to the PDP but put the party in disarray in the state

“We would like to use this medium to call on critical stakeholders and the National Secretariat of the PDP, to consider immediate actions to help remedy the lack of clear purposeful and committed leadership we are saddled with currently in the Ondo state chapter.

“While we understand the need for a post mortem of the total failure of the party in the last elections, we must emphasize the need to have an immediate overhaul of the party machineries, to enable us ample time to deal with preparations for the forthcoming Gubernatorial elections in Ondo state.

“While not giving a deadline to those who have been found culpable in the dismal and disappointing performance of our party in the last election, we do advise that those who may be unwilling to yield the reins of leadership in the party to more competent and purposeful leadership, to consider their honor and concede to a rebuilding process for the party.

“Finally, while acknowledging the daunting task of rebuilding confidence amongst loyal party members ahead of party, we insist that the current leadership of the party should step aside and give room for an unbiased caretaker committee while investigations be conducted to ascertain allegations of culpability on their part in the loss we have all suffered” the statement said
